I will never forget my trip to Italy in 2000. I was on a boat on the Adriatic Sea. There were tourists from different countries, too. A teenage boy with his father sat in front of me. The captain stopped the boat after 35 minutes in the middle of the sea. It was warm and the view was beautiful! We all stood up to look around. The teenager wanted to look at the fish and went closer to the water. Guess what? He fell into the water! We were all shocked and didn't know what to do! Suddenly, we saw two big dolphins in the sea. The dolphins noticed the boy in the sea and swam to help! One of them lifted the boy and threw him into the boat! That was incredible! The dolphin rescued the boy! His father was very grateful to his son's rescuer! I will remember this story forever!

Once, I was walking outside with my mum and sister. It was freezing cold. Suddenly, I noticed a man and a little girl sitting on a stone in the park. They looked miserable and hungry. The girl was wearing a thin jacket and her father was wearing a shirt in the middle of the autumn. I looked at my warm clothes and felt embarrassed. I had everything, but these people didn't. They were homeless, hungry and helpless. That day, we came back home and decided to help homeless people in our city. We collected clothes from our neighbours. My sister had a great plan. She asked my parents to put boxes with the clothes in the park for homeless people. We wrote on the boxes: "Please take what you need!". Everyone helped us. We put more than 12 boxes full of clothes for homeless people. That day was the happiest day of our life.
